Before you order
Measure the standing height that suits you: elbows at roughly 90 degrees with your hands on the keyboard. If that number is above 55 in, this cart will not reach it.
Good to know
The work surfaces are particleboard on a steel frame, not solid wood or all steel. That is what keeps it at 22 lb and rolling easily, and it is also why the 88 lb rating should be read as a limit rather than a target. Assembly is required and the hardware is in the box.
